The surrounding mountains and valley seem to unfold before you at this beautifully situated home just outside Enumclaw. There's no shortage of space to gather here, with multiple living rooms, a light-filled sun room, and a back deck - with a private hot tub - that runs the length of the house.

This home is both special and familiar, with a floor plan that gives you plentiful options for spending time with your loved ones. As you enter on the ground floor, you'll find living spaces across the house. At one end is a window-lined sitting room with leather seating, a gas stove, and a stereo system; at the other is a great room with two-story ceilings, a flatscreen TV, and a second gas stove. The spaces in between are just as comfortable and inviting. There's a formal dining room with an eight-person table, as well as a fully appointed kitchen with all the essential appliances (including a gas range, a French-door refrigerator, and a dishwasher) and eat-in seating for eight more guests.

An enclosed sun porch leads outside to an expansive wrap-around deck, a private hot tub overlooking the valley, and a patio around the side of the home with a gas grill and a basketball hoop. Back inside, you'll find even more space to relax in the upstairs family room - a great place to play board games, watch DVDs, chat at the built-in bar, or even get a bit of work done at the desk using the free WiFi.

At night, all four bedrooms are located on the second floor, including a primary suite with a spacious private bathroom. A washer/dryer is also provided.

About the area

Enumclaw

Located in Enumclaw, this vacation home is in a rural area and in the mountains. The area's natural beauty can be seen at Lake Tapps and Big Spring/Newaukum Creek Natural Area, while White River Amphitheatre and Thunder Dome Car Museum are cultural highlights. Looking to enjoy an event or a game while in town? See what's happening at Petes Pool or Pacific Raceways. Be sure to check out the area's animals with activities such as game walks and birdwatching.
